Why You Must Stage Your Home Before You Sell It

Not staging a home is not an option in my book. It’s an absolute must. 

But what does staging entail exactly? As a seller, what would you have to do? 

The purpose of staging is to “set the stage” for the sale, so that buyers are enticed to buy your home. Many people think of staging as putting cool furniture and decor in the house when it’s for sale. That’s only a small part of it, and the part that’s only done after many other crucial things happen, such as:

  • Decluttering
  • Cleaning
  • Fixing 
  • Painting
  • Updating

If you do not attend to these details, it will be harder for buyers to want to buy your home. These things become objections. Issues. Reasons to pass. No thank you…moving on.

The way will live in our homes and the way we present them for sale are very different.

With staging, the goal is to get your home in the best shape it can be within the constraints of your time and budget. Because admittedly, those are very real. We can’t do everything. With guidance from a professional on what needs to be done, and a ranking of priorities, you can feel comfortable knowing exactly what you need to do to get your house ready for sale. And by making a diligent effort to showcase it at its best, you can set your house apart as the one the buyers want to buy.
